JOB DESCRIPTION

 

 

JOB TITLE:  Buyer                                                                  FLSA STATUS:  Exempt

 

REPORTS TO:  Manager, Supply Chain (Purchasing)

 

 

SUMMARY

Responsible for the sourcing and ongoing management of purchased direct materials and components.

 

RESPONSIBILITIES AND DUTIES

Under general supervision is responsible for the following major tasks:

 

Ÿ    Investigate and select sources for purchased materials in cooperation with Engineering and consistent with commodity strategies.

 

Ÿ    Achieve cost reductions through price/contract negotiations for purchased items.  Monitor contracts to assure that Summit is taking best advantage of the contracts and that the contracts achieve the intended goals.

 

  • Develop commodity expertise in order to attain lowest cost, and select the best materials for Summit’s applications.

 

Ÿ    Select and develop the highest performing sources in coordination with Supplier Development.

 

Ÿ    Work with Summit’s cost estimators to develop and determine the optimum material prices and cost models for quoting purposes.

 

Ÿ    Facilitate Summit personnel in gaining access to supplier expertise, technology, and manufacturing support.

 

Ÿ    Actively participate in the New Business Development and APQP processes to ensure that the materials purchased for new products are consistent with corporate purchasing strategy and within quoted cost targets.

 

Ÿ    Manage milestones, deliverables and prototype purchased parts for new programs during product launch cycles.

 

Ÿ    Initiate, lead, or support VA/VE activities related to purchased materials to improve cost competitiveness and margin

 

Ÿ    Coordinate Supply Chain parameters for purchased sources in cooperation with Logistics and Summit Plant Materials.

 

  • Promote strong relationships with SPI suppliers built on mutual respect, shared goals, open communication, and integrity.

 

Ÿ    Provide support to all other Summit functions as needed.

 

 

E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E

  • Bachelor’s degree and 3 years purchasing or supply chain experience.  Experience in the Automotive Industry preferred.

 

SKILLS AND ABILITIES:

  • Possesses the ability to gather and analyze information and make decisions from a limited number of choices.
  • A minimum score of 50 on the Wonderlic Select Assessment (Traditional Score of 26 on the cognitive portion).

 

TRAVEL REQUIREMENTS

This position typically does require up to 25% travel.
